When patients need to travel throughout the hospital, the Patient Transporter will help lift, turn, and move them to the proper transport equipment.
You will ensure transport equipment is safe for the patients and report any defects quickly. When not transporting patients, you will clean the equipment, change lines as needed and communicate delays or concerns regarding transport to dispatch.

The Physical Therapist plans and provides treatment to meet a patient’s rehabilitation goals.
You will develop and implement the physical therapy plan and establish a plan of care for patients.
You will advocate, communicate, and educate patients of all ages while showing competence, awareness, and sensitivity of their physical, emotional and sociopsychological needs.
This role provides a leadership opportunity as you will mentor PTAs, students, and volunteers.

The Registered Nurse (RN) is the core of ProMedica’s world-class patient care team. By providing patient-centered care through sensitivity and respect for the diversity of human experience, ProMedica nurses are dedicated to improving health outcomes for our patients and for the communities we serve.
As the coordinator of a patient’s plan of care, you will interact with the patient, families and the health care team through open communication, mutual respect, and shared decision-making. The RN will assess and formulate a nursing diagnosis, and plan, implement and evaluate the effectiveness of the care plan.
In this position, you will work collaboratively with fellow nurses and support staff as you strive to achieve patient care goals. As a ProMedica RN, you will work to improve patient care, your work environment and patient and staff satisfaction.
The above summary is intended to describe the general nature and level of work performed by the positions. It should not be considered exhaustive.
REQUIREMENTS
- Current State license as a Registered Nurse
- Current CPR training. Specialty certifications as required by individual nursing units.
- The RN in Ohio must complete twenty-four contact hours of continuing education during his/her licensure period. At least 1 hour of contact hours must be related to Chapter 4723 of the Ohio nurse practice code and rules.

ProMedica Security Officers ensure the overall safety of our patients, visitors, and employees. While monitoring facilities, the officers also help people who have questions about where they should go.
In this vital safety role, you will regulate and control all traffic, parking enforcement and traffic control when needed. You will investigate and report all accidents, hazards, and incidents. The officer will need to restrain combative patients as needed.
Once in this position, you must successfully complete all required training and remain current in any certifications.
